Low-Carb Pasta Alternatives

Finding suitable low-carb pasta alternatives is essential for anyone following a Mediterranean keto diet. Options like konjac noodles, zucchini, or spaghetti squash offer familiar textures with fewer carbs. You can serve these alternatives with various Mediterranean sauces or cooked with Mediterranean herbs to maximize their flavor. This approach helps you enjoy traditional dishes while staying compliant with your ketogenic goals.

4. How can I prepare low-carb pasta alternatives?

To prepare low-carb pasta alternatives, you can spiralize zucchini or use shirataki noodles. These alternatives deliver a similar texture to traditional pasta while maintaining low carbohydrate content, allowing you to enjoy dishes like pasta salads or hearty lunches easily.

5. Are there any Mediterranean cheeses suitable for a ketogenic diet?

Absolutely! Cheeses like feta, mozzarella, and parmesan are excellent choices for a [strong]Mediterranean keto diet[/strong]. They are high in fats and low in carbohydrates, making them versatile for various meals and snacks while adding flavors to your dishes.
